About This Course

The 192-hour Oil & Gas Safety & Health Manager program is an advanced professional development course specifically tailored for individuals supervising safety in the exploration, drilling, production, and refining sectors. The curriculum is meticulously structured to address the unique challenges of the oil and gas industry, ranging from offshore safety protocols to onshore extraction hazards. It provides a deep dive into regulatory standards and safety management systems.

Beyond basic compliance, this course emphasizes the development of a proactive safety culture. Students will explore complex topics such as process safety management, industrial hygiene, and emergency response planning. The training ensures that graduates are not only capable of identifying risks but are also equipped to implement sustainable safety solutions that protect personnel and assets while maintaining operational efficiency.

Course Content

Explore the comprehensive 192 Hour – Oil & Gas Safety & Health Manager course content designed to help you master the material through structured modules and lessons.

1. Introduction to Safety Management

1
Principles of safety leadership
2
Historical perspectives on safety
3
The moral and financial impact of safety

2. Effective Safety Committee Operations

3. Effective Accident Investigation

4. Introduction to OSH Training

5. Hazards Analysis & Control

6. Hazard Communication Program

7. Conducting a Job Hazard Analysis

8. OSHA 300 Record Keeping

9. Safety Supervision & Leadership

10. Confined Space Program

11. Fall Protection Program

12. Safety Management System Evaluation

13. Emergency Action Plan

14. Fire Prevention Plan

15. Fleet Safety Management

16. Preventing Workplace Violence

17. Ergonomic Program Management

18. Introduction to Process Safety Management (PSM)

19. Introduction to Industrial Hygiene

20. Hearing Conservation Program Management

21. Bloodborne Pathogens Program Management

22. Trench & Excavation Safety

23. Fall Protection in Construction

24. Oil & Gas Safety Management

25. Oil & Gas Hazards Awareness

26. Well Site Preparation & Drilling Safety

27. Well Site Completion & Servicing Safety

28. Oil & Gas Well Inspection

29. Oil Spill Cleanup

30. Introduction to SEMS 2

31. Offshore Oil & Gas Safety 1

32. Offshore Oil & Gas Safety 2
